# Java Date:计算日期差
## 简介
在日常开发中,我们经常需要计算两个日期之间的差值。Java提供了Date类和相关的API来处理日期和时间。本文将介绍如何使用Java Date类来计算日期差,并提供相应的代码示例。
## Date类
Java的Date类是用于表示日期和时间的类。它提供了一系列的构造方法和方法来操作日期和时间。下面是Date类的类图:
```mermaid
原创
2024-01-05 07:24:39
118阅读
# Java Date 月份差的实现方法
## 介绍
在Java中,计算两个日期对象之间的月份差是一个常见的需求。本文将教会刚入行的小白开发者如何实现这个功能。
## 流程
下面是整个实现过程的流程图:
```mermaid
stateDiagram
[*] --> 开始
开始 --> 创建日期对象: 创建需要计算的两个日期对象
创建日期对象 --> 获取年份: 获取
原创
2023-12-08 11:19:18
38阅读
# 计算Java Date的年份差
## 1. 整体流程
为了计算Java Date的年份差,我们可以按照以下步骤进行操作:
1. 获取两个日期对象。
2. 将日期对象转换为Calendar对象。
3. 使用Calendar对象计算两个日期之间的年份差。
下面我们将详细介绍每一步的实现方法。
## 2. 具体步骤
| 步骤 | 描述 |
|------|------|
| 步骤1 |
原创
2023-08-25 12:56:15
292阅读
# Java Date时间差计算
## 1. 引言
在Java开发中,经常需要计算两个日期之间的时间差,例如计算两个事件之间的时间间隔、计算某个事件距离当前时间的时间差等等。本文将指导你如何使用Java的Date类来实现这些时间差的计算。
## 2. 流程概述
下面是计算时间差的整体流程概述:
```mermaid
pie
title 时间差计算流程
"输入日期时间" : 1
原创
2023-08-20 06:34:41
641阅读
java.text.DateFormat format1 = new java.text.SimpleDateFormat("yyyy-MM-dd hh:mm:ss");
Calendar nowTime = C
原创
2015-11-30 11:47:01
2612阅读
# Java Date计算日期差
## 简介
在Java中,我们经常需要计算日期之间的差距,比如计算两个日期相隔多少天、多少小时、多少分钟等。Java的Date类提供了一些方法来实现这个功能。本文将介绍如何使用Java Date类来计算日期差。
## 步骤
下面是计算日期差的步骤: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 创建两个Date对象,表示要计算差距的两个
原创
2023-08-03 15:55:15
1493阅读
# 如何实现Java Date计算天数差
## 概述
在Java中,我们可以使用`java.util.Date`类和`java.time.LocalDate`类来计算日期之间的天数差。本文将详细介绍如何实现这一功能。
### 流程
```mermaid
flowchart TD
A(开始)
B(创建两个日期对象)
C(计算日期差)
D(获取天数差)
E(
原创
2024-05-05 03:37:54
37阅读
# Java Date计算天数差
在Java中,要计算两个日期之间的天数差,我们可以使用`java.util.Date`和`java.util.Calendar`两个类来实现。在这篇文章中,我们将介绍如何使用这两个类来计算天数差,并提供相应的代码示例。
## 1. 使用java.util.Date
`java.util.Date`类表示特定的瞬间,可以精确到毫秒。要计算两个日期之间的天数差,
原创
2023-12-21 08:11:51
168阅读
# 计算Java中的月份差
在Java开发中,经常会遇到需要处理日期和时间的情况,尤其是在进行某些计算时,计算两个日期之间的月份差是一个常见且重要的任务。本文将详细介绍如何在Java中计算月份差,并提供代码示例,帮助大家对这一操作有更深刻的理解。
## 1. Java中的日期处理
Java提供了多个类来处理时间和日期,最常用的有 `java.util.Date` 和 `java.time`
javascript 自带有个对象(构造函数),Date().下面是代码:var oDate = new Date(); //实例一个时间对象;
oDate.getFullYear(); //获取系统的年;
oDate.getMonth()+1; //获取系统月份,由于月份是从0开始计算,所以要加1
oDate.getDate(); // 获取系统日,
oDate.getHours();
转载
2023-06-09 20:48:19
94阅读
Java 语言的Calendar(日历),Date(日期), 和DateFormat(日期格式)组成了Java标准的一个基本但是非常重要的部分. 日期是商业逻辑计算一个关键的部分. 所有的开发者都应该能够计算未来的日期, 定制日期的显示格式, 并将文本数据解析成日期对象. 我们将讨论下面的类: 1、具体类(和抽象类相对)java.util.Date 2、抽象类java.text.Da
转载
2024-01-08 18:02:17
19阅读
# 如何使用Java计算Date时间差
在日常编程中,我们经常需要计算两个时间点之间的时间差。在Java中,我们可以使用Date类和Calendar类来实现这个功能。本文将介绍如何使用Java计算Date时间差,并提供一些代码示例帮助您更好地理解。
## Date类
在Java中,Date类用于表示日期和时间。我们可以使用Date类来表示一个特定的时间点。Date类提供了一些方法来比较两个时
原创
2024-06-09 05:22:04
116阅读
# 计算时间差:Java中的Date类使用详解
在软件开发中,处理时间和日期是一个常见的任务。Java语言在其标准库中提供了多种日期和时间的处理方式,其中最基础的就是 `java.util.Date` 类。尽管近年来有了 `java.time` 包的引入,但遗留代码中往往还使用着 `Date` 类。本文将详细介绍如何使用 `Date` 类计算时间差,并提供示例代码。
## 1. Date类概述
1、java 7中的日历类CalendarCalendar类使用其静态的getInstance()方法获取一个日历实例,该实例为当前的时间;如果想改变时间,可以通过其setTime方法传入一个Date对象,即可获得Date对象所表示时间的Calendar对象/**
*使用Calendar对象计算时间差,可以按照需求定制自己的计算逻辑
* @param strDate
* @throws Pa
转载
2023-08-14 21:34:16
76阅读
时间和日期处理,在一个应用中都是很重要的,掌握时间和日期类的处理也是很重要的。Java中的Calendar类和Date类,在java.util包下。在JDK1.0中,Date类是唯一处理时间的类,但是由于Date类中方法比较少并且有一些方法不便于实现国际化,所以从JDK1.1版本开始新增了Calendar类,增加了许多功能强大的方法,推荐使用 Calendar类进行时间和日期处理。下面开始总结Da
转载
2023-07-25 20:38:38
83阅读
# 如何在Java中获取两个日期之间的天数差
在 Java 中获取两个日期之间的天数差是一个常见的需求。这篇文章将帮助刚入行的开发者学会如何实现这一功能。我们将通过以下几个步骤来完成这个任务:
## 流程概览
| 步骤 | 描述 | 代码示例 |
|------|------------------------
原创
2024-08-18 05:36:36
39阅读
# 计算时间差的Java代码示例
在Java中,我们可以使用`Date`类来计算两个时间点之间的时间差。`Date`类表示特定的时间点,我们可以使用它来进行日期和时间的比较。
下面我们会介绍如何使用`Date`类来计算时间差,并给出相应的代码示例。
## 计算时间差的步骤
1. 创建两个`Date`对象,分别表示两个时间点。
2. 使用`getTime()`方法获取每个`Date`对象的时
原创
2024-06-19 05:15:04
102阅读
# Java库计算Date时间差:新手指南
在Java中,计算两个日期之间的时间差是一个常见的需求。无论是为了进行业务计算还是用户体验,了解如何正确地处理日期对象是非常重要的。本文将指导你通过几个简单的步骤实现这一功能,适合新手理解。
## 流程概述
以下是实现日期时间差的基本流程:
| 步骤 | 说明 |
|------|------|
| 1 | 导入必要的Java库 |
| 2
原创
2024-08-30 04:30:43
134阅读
## 计算时间差的常用方法
在日常开发中,我们经常会遇到需要计算时间差的情况。比如,在某个业务场景中,需要统计某个操作的耗时时间,或者需要计算两个时间点之间的时间间隔。Java中提供了`java.util.Date`类和`java.time.Duration`类来处理时间和时间间隔的计算。
下面我们将通过一个实际问题来演示如何使用Java来计算时间差,并给出相应的示例代码。本文假设你已经有了一
原创
2023-12-05 06:10:45
89阅读
# 如何实现“java Date 获取时间差 天”
## 1. 流程图
```mermaid
pie
title 开发时间差天功能的流程
"理解需求" : 10
"编写代码" : 40
"测试代码" : 20
"优化代码" : 20
"完成" : 10
```
## 2. 步骤
| 步骤 | 操作 |
| :---: | --- |
| 1
原创
2024-06-29 04:31:41
29阅读